BreakingIndia's Credit Growth Surges: 74% Indians to Seek Loans by 2026, Led by Women & Non-Metro Areas
India is experiencing a remarkable expansion in its credit market, with the percentage of eligible citizens opting for loans projected to reach 74% by 2026, a significant leap from 34% in 2017. This robust growth is primarily driven by increasing financial participation from women, younger borrowers, and consumers residing in non-metro regions across the country, indicating a profound shift in financial inclusion.
BreakingUPI Transactions Soar to Record ₹29.9 Lakh Crore in July
India's popular Unified Payments Interface (UPI) recorded a new high in July, processing transactions worth a staggering ₹29.9 lakh crore. This monumental figure was achieved across 23.66 billion transactions, marking a significant 19% increase in value compared to last year.
Suzuki's Next Bharat Ventures Launches ₹2,000 Crore Fund for Rural Startups
Suzuki Motor Corporation's subsidiary, Next Bharat Ventures, has unveiled a ₹2,000 crore impact fund. This fund aims to support early-stage Indian startups focused on improving lives and economies in rural and underserved communities, particularly in agriculture and financial inclusion.
